Denim and Canvas Finishes Give a Casual Appeal to Interiors:

If you have a home with a formal style, then you may prefer a faux finish that comes with a slight pattern. This is just like your favorite denim jeans look for denim painting techniques. This type of small patterned faux finish can be achieved by using a small brush and dragging it vertically as well as horizontally through the paint for a small pattern, similar to casual denim.

Marbleizing Looks and Architectural Details:

These types of faux finishes are much popular among those who love the look of the veins in marble but can’t afford expensive materials in the interiors. For this, you have to look for a faux finish technique known as marbleizing that actually helps create the variegated looks of veins in the marble. At the same time, it increases the beauty of the varied colors with just a paint brush and the right paint.
